How to Use a Galvanic Battery in Medicine and Surgery: A Discourse Delivered Before the Hunterian Society, Third Edition, is a comprehensive and authoritative guide to the medical and surgical applications of galvanic electricity, authored by Herbert Tibbits. This classic work, first delivered as a discourse before the esteemed Hunterian Society, explores the principles, mechanisms, and practical uses of the galvanic battery—a revolutionary device in 19th-century medicine. Tibbits meticulously explains the construction and operation of various types of galvanic batteries, providing detailed instructions on their safe and effective use in clinical settings. The book delves into the physiological effects of galvanic currents on the human body, discussing their therapeutic potential in treating a wide range of conditions, from neuralgia and paralysis to muscular atrophy and chronic pain. Tibbits presents numerous case studies and clinical observations, illustrating the benefits and limitations of electrotherapy. He also addresses the scientific theories underpinning galvanism, offering insights into the contemporary understanding of electricity’s role in biological processes. With clear explanations, practical advice, and a wealth of historical context, this third edition serves as both a valuable reference for medical professionals and a fascinating glimpse into the evolution of medical technology.
